5 February 2021

After a few months break, I invite you to another presentation of my author's photo exhibition entitled "Obary" prepared on the occasion of the 45th anniversary of the protection of natural fragments of transitional and raised bogs of the subcontinental type located in the western part of the Solska Primeval Forest. The exhibition will start on February 15 at the Atelier Gallery in Chel‚m. The exhibition will feature 20 photographs in the format of 82x55 cm, framed by 100x70 cm, showing the characteristic elements of the landscape of the reserve, photographed in the existing conditions over four seasons. The photos were taken in the years 2012-2019 during the validity of the relevant permit allowing me to move around the protected area and photograph nature. The exhibition was created thanks to the support of the Polish Nature Photographers Union, the Bil‚goraj Forest District and the Bil‚goraj Commune. The presentation will last until March 6 this year and will end with a finalization combined with the presentation of my original digital shows.

I invite you to the opening of the main photo exhibition of the 18th Wlodzimierz Puchalski International Nature Film Festival, which will be held on September 22 at 5:00 p.m. at the Eugeniusz Haneman Photography Gallery of the Lodz Photographic Society located at 102 Piotrkowska Street in Lodz. The exhibition "Biodiversity as an opportunity for the Earth" consists of 30 photographs enlarged to the format 50x70 cm by 10 invited nature photographers. Among the names of the awarded authors, there are also my and three signed works.

"There are pictures of animals that symbolise the success of protecting and preserving biodiversity. Such are undoubtedly bisons, elks and beavers. We have those that are currently endangered and require good decisions and careful protection. It is undoubtedly both the capercaillie and the black grouse, but also the hoopoe, threatened with destruction of trees in the fields. There are two charming wild boars, so much needed by the environment, and yet officially doomed...

There are some photos missing at the exhibition. The photos made by a man who was always there and now "stubbornly stays disappeared". Tomek Ogrodowczyk was one of the first to confirm his participation. He did not have time to send the photos. The authors unanimously decided to dedicate this year's exhibition to him, the Great Absent. To one of the greatest connoisseurs and propagators of biodiversity and beauty of Polish nature.

We cordially invite you to the Eugeniusz Haneman Gallery of the Lodz Photographic Society for the festival exhibition. Biodiversity really is Earth's chance - and man's only chance for survival."
